Ba Tơ (About this soundlisten) is a rural district (huyện) of Quảng Ngãi Province in the South Central Coast region of Vietnam. As of 2003 the district had a population of 47,268.[1] The district covers an area of 1,133 km². The district capital lies at Ba Tơ.[1]

In April 2012, there have been multiple reports of an outbreak of an unknown fatal disease in the area around Ba Tơ. See Quảng Ngãi skin disease outbreak for more details.
